Northwest Spitzbergen
View information
View of the northwest part of the island of Spitzbergen, Svalbard which forms a peninsula separated from the rest of the island by the Isfjorden on the bottom left and the Wijdefjorden on the right. This part of the island is particularly notable for the red sandstone mountains that contrast here with the white of the glaciers and the green coasts of the fjords. Uses data from the Norwegian Polar Institute (CC-By 4.0).
